INSTALLATION TYPE

LOADS

Fa - Axial force, loads all springs in shear
Fc - Vertical force, loads all springs in compression
Ft - Vertical force, loads all springs in tension
Fh - Horizontal force, loads one spring in compression and the other in tension
Note: Riverhawk engineers recommend calculating the comparative force (pressure) FLC and (tension) FLT using the following equations
FLC = 1.0 x Fc - Load applies pressure to both springs.
FLT = 1.0 x Ft - Load applies tension to both springs.
FLC = 1.41 x Pc - Load applies pressure to only one spring.
FLT = 1.41 x Pt - Load applies tension to only one spring.
For combined loads and force directions Fa or Fh, please contact a consulting engineer.
DETERMINING THE FREE-FLEX PIVOT SIZE
Select the appropriate size where FLC < FC or FLC < FT is permissible. For further technical information on the appropriate product, please select the series in the order inquiry.
